Dutchess, Ulster, and Columbia counties report more COVID-19 deaths in October
Nov 02, 2022 12:23 pm
Paul Kirby reports in the Daily Freeman that Dutchess County had nine more COVID-19 deaths in October, and Ulster County reported three more. Dutchess County also reports more active cases now than a month ago. On Oct. 28 officials there said there were 256 active COVID-19 cases, up from from 186 on Oct. 3. Ulster County reported 206 active cases now, down from the 350 reported on Oct. 3. Columbia County also reported one death from COVID-19 in October, while Greene County did not.
